AI Technical Summary
Existing computer cable quick connectors are easily damaged by pulling, affecting the normal operation of network equipment.
A quick connector for computer cables was designed, comprising a shield, connecting rod, tension spring, rotating rod, and shield structure. Through the cooperation of positioning groove and positioning plate, and auxiliary block and trapezoidal groove, quick insertion and anti-pull are achieved. The protrusion and tension spring structure are used for buffering to avoid damage to the connector.
It achieves dust protection when not in use, ensuring connection effectiveness, and provides multi-directional guidance during the insertion process to prevent pulling damage, thereby improving the durability and reliability of the connector.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of cable connector technology, specifically a quick connector for computer cables. Background Technology
[0002] Some computer cable quick connectors, such as network cable connectors and fiber optic connectors, while primarily used for data signal transmission, also indirectly interact with the power supply system while ensuring normal communication of computer network equipment. Network devices such as routers and switches require power from the power supply system to operate. Computers connect to these network devices via quick connectors to transmit and share data, enabling the entire network system to function normally with power support. However, existing computer cables are exposed, inevitably leading to personnel pulling on them. This may pull out the connectors, causing the computer to stop and damaging the connectors, resulting in significant losses. Therefore, this invention proposes a computer cable quick connector to solve the above problems. Utility Model Content

[0019] Please see Figures 1 to 5 This utility model provides a technical solution: a quick connector for computer cables, comprising...
[0020] A first connecting block 1 has a connecting plate 2 fixedly installed on its side. A sliding groove 3 is provided on the side of the connecting plate 2, and a positioning component is fixedly installed on the top of the sliding groove 3. A mating interface 4 is provided on the side of the first connecting block 1, and a second connecting block 5 is inserted and mated in the mating interface 4.
[0021] The second connecting block 5 has a sloping groove 6 at the top and a positioning groove 7 at the top of the sloping groove 6. The second connecting block 5 has a snap-fit groove at the bottom and an auxiliary block 8 at the bottom. The connecting plate 2 has an auxiliary component on its side. The sloping groove 6 has a simple structure and is convenient for quickly positioning the connector.
[0022] The positioning assembly includes a guide block 9, which is fixedly connected to the top of the slide groove 3. A movable block 10 is slidably arranged on the side of the guide block 9, and a positioning post 11 is fixedly connected to the top of the movable block 10. A positioning plate 12 is fixedly connected to the top of the positioning post 11, and the positioning plate 12 and the positioning groove 7 are plugged into each other. A telescopic rod 13 is slidably arranged on the top of the movable block 10, and a compression spring 14 is fixedly connected to the top of the movable block 10. The compression spring 14 is sleeved on the side of the telescopic rod 13. A protrusion 15 is fixedly connected to the side of the movable block 10, and an arc groove 16 is fixedly arranged at the bottom of the protrusion 15. The positioning assembly is designed with a reasonable structure, simple operation, and facilitates quick assembly and disassembly of the connector.
[0023] The auxiliary components include a connecting rod 17, which is slidably disposed on the side of the connecting plate 2. A tension spring 18 is sleeved on the side of the connecting rod 17. A rotating rod 19 is disposed on the side of the connecting rod 17, and a cover plate 20 is fixedly connected to the side of the rotating rod 19. The cover plate 20 is engaged with the arc groove 16 to cover the interface of the plug when not in use, so as to prevent dust from falling inside and affecting the connection effect of the device.
[0024] The side of the shield 20 is symmetrically provided with a balancing inclined block 21, and the top of the balancing inclined block 21 is fixedly provided with a snap-fit crossbar 23. The snap-fit crossbar 23 can be snapped into the arc groove 16. The positioning groove 7 and the positioning plate 12, the auxiliary block 8 and the trapezoidal groove 22, and the second connecting block 5 and the balancing inclined block 21 are respectively positioned to guide the connector from multiple directions and complete the quick insertion process. The snap-fit crossbar 23 in the auxiliary component snaps into the second connecting block 5, which plays a role in buffering and preventing pulling, thus avoiding damage to the connector caused by pulling the cable.
[0025] In practical use: First, when the connector is not in use, engage the locking crossbar 23 at the top of the cover plate with the arc groove 16. The compression spring 14 pushes the movable block 10 and its protrusion 15, and the arc groove 16 applies pressure to the locking crossbar 23 to prevent it from disengaging. When the connector operation is required, first push the protrusion 15 upward to release the locking crossbar 23. The rotating rod 19 then flattens the entire cover plate. Then, the auxiliary block 8 and the trapezoidal groove 22, and the second connecting block 5 and the balance inclined block 21 are respectively positioned. The second connecting block 5 is smoothly pushed into the interface 4. During the sliding process, the compression spring 14 pushes the movable block 10 and the positioning post 11 downward, which will cause the positioning plate 12 to slide in contact with the top of the inclined groove 6 until the positioning plate 12 and the positioning groove 7 are connected, thus completing the connector operation.
